In January 2021, just before the Trump administration departed, the U.S. Department of Education issued a legal memo (which has since been ripped down by the Biden White House) stating the secretary of Education “does not have the statutory authority to cancel, compromise, discharge, or forgive, on a blanket or mass basis, principal balances of student loans, and/or to materially modify the repayment amounts or terms thereof.”
